WinForm Visifire 怎么添加事件

avatar
作者
筋斗云
阅读量:0

在 WinForm 的 Visifire 控件中添加事件,通常涉及以下几个步骤:

  1. 引入 Visifire 命名空间:确保在代码文件的顶部引入了 Visifire 的命名空间,以便能够访问控件的相关方法和属性。
  2. 创建 Visifire 控件实例:在 WinForm 的设计器中,将 Visifire 控件(如 Chart)拖放到窗体上,或者在代码中创建其实例。
  3. 查找事件源:确定要处理的事件的源头,例如 Chart 控件的某个数据系列(Series)。
  4. 添加事件处理程序:根据所需的事件类型(如 DataBound、SelectionChanged 等),为事件源添加相应的事件处理程序。这通常是通过在代码中编写事件处理方法的签名,并将其与事件源关联起来来实现的。

以下是一个示例,展示了如何在 WinForm 的 Visifire Chart 控件中添加 DataBound 事件处理程序:

// 确保引入了 Visifire 命名空间 using Visifire.Charts;  public partial class MyForm : Form {     public MyForm()     {         InitializeComponent();          // 创建 Chart 控件实例(如果尚未创建)         if (chart1 == null)         {             chart1 = new Chart();             chart1.Dock = DockStyle.Fill;             this.Controls.Add(chart1);         }          // 配置 Chart 控件(示例:添加数据系列)         Series series = new Series();         series.Name = "MySeries";         series.DataBind(new object[] { 1, 2, 3, 4, 5 }, new string[] { "A", "B", "C", "D", "E" });         chart1.Series.Add(series);          // 为 DataBound 事件添加处理程序         series.DataBound += new EventHandler(Series_DataBound);     }      // 数据绑定事件处理程序     private void Series_DataBound(object sender, EventArgs e)     {         // 在这里编写处理数据绑定的代码         MessageBox.Show("数据绑定完成!");     } } 

请注意,上述示例中的代码可能需要根据您的具体需求和 Visifire 控件的版本进行调整。此外,Visifire 控件可能提供了其他丰富的事件和处理选项,您可以查阅相关文档以获取更多信息。

广告一刻

为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!